Taro Logo

Principal ML Engineer, Recommendation Systems

A profitable digital media company reaching 30M+ monthly visitors through brands like FinanceBuzz, All About Cookies, and OnlyInYourState.
Machine Learning
Principal Software Engineer
Remote
101 - 500 Employees
10+ years of experience
AI · Enterprise SaaS · Consumer

Job Description

Launch Potato, a thriving digital media company, is seeking a Principal ML Engineer to lead their recommendation systems initiatives. With a reach of over 30M+ monthly visitors through prominent brands like FinanceBuzz and All About Cookies, this role offers an exciting opportunity to shape the future of personalization technology. As a remote-first company headquartered in South Florida with team members across 15+ countries, Launch Potato offers a dynamic, high-performance culture focused on speed and measurable impact.

The ideal candidate will bring 10+ years of expertise in large-scale machine learning systems, particularly in personalization and recommendation systems. You'll be responsible for establishing the technical vision for personalization across the company, solving complex ML challenges, and influencing strategy and architecture across teams. This role combines deep technical leadership with strategic thinking, requiring expertise in advanced ML techniques like deep learning, causal inference, and graph-based models.

This position offers the chance to work on cutting-edge ML solutions, mentor senior engineers, and represent Launch Potato in the broader technical community. You'll be instrumental in driving innovation while balancing technical excellence with business impact. The role requires someone who can think visually, execute expertly, and lead through influence while maintaining a curious, forward-looking approach to new technologies and methodologies.

If you're passionate about building scalable ML systems that serve billions of predictions and want to work in a fast-paced, remote-first environment where you can make a significant impact, this role presents an exceptional opportunity to advance your career while shaping the future of personalization technology.

Last updated a day ago

Responsibilities For Principal ML Engineer, Recommendation Systems

  • Define company-wide personalization strategy and architecture, driving alignment across all ML teams
  • Solve critical technical challenges such as cold start, real-time learning, and exploration/exploitation tradeoffs
  • Design and implement advanced ML solutions using cutting-edge techniques
  • Create and enforce ML architecture patterns, design standards, and reusable infrastructure
  • Lead multi-quarter, cross-functional initiatives
  • Act as technical mentor to senior ML engineers
  • Represent Launch Potato's technical brand externally
  • Champion privacy-preserving personalization, responsible AI practices, and adaptive learning systems

Requirements For Principal ML Engineer, Recommendation Systems

Python
  • Expertise building ML systems with deep expertise in large-scale personalization
  • Recognized industry expertise through patents, publications, or significant product impact
  • Proven success architecting ML platforms serving billions of predictions in production
  • Demonstrated track record of 0→1 innovation in personalization or recommender systems
  • Mastery across multiple ML domains including deep learning, causal inference, multi-armed bandits, and graph-based models
  • 10+ years designing, developing, and deploying large-scale machine learning systems

Related Jobs

Principal ML Engineer, Ad Performance

Principal ML Engineer position at Launch Potato focusing on ad performance and personalization, requiring 10+ years of experience in large-scale machine learning systems.

Principal ML Engineer, Ad Performance

Principal ML Engineer position at Launch Potato focusing on ad performance and personalization systems, requiring 10+ years of experience in large-scale machine learning.

Principal Machine Learning Engineer, Ad Performance

Principal Machine Learning Engineer position at Launch Potato focusing on ad performance and personalization, requiring 10+ years of experience in large-scale ML systems.

Principal ML Engineer, Ad Performance

Principal ML Engineer position at Launch Potato focusing on ad performance and personalization, requiring 10+ years of experience in large-scale ML systems.

Principal ML Engineer, Ad Performance

Principal ML Engineer position at Launch Potato focusing on ad performance and personalization, requiring 10+ years of experience in large-scale ML systems.